A Psalm for the Wild-Built is a cozy sci-fi about a tea monk (Dex) and a robot (Mosscap) in a wonderful world that gives me hope for the future.
The most impactful part for me was a discussion about meaning/purpose that happens toward the end. Mosscap’s perspective is exactly what I wanted/needed to hear.
I gave it 3.5 stars because while I liked it, I felt that Dex wasn’t very relatable. I guess I’m just not restless like they are, so it made reading their perspective a little frustrating at times. Even so, I did appreciate them.
I want to emphasize that I did like it overall, and I’d highly recommend it. Looking forward to continuing this series!
